Python analog of PHP’s natsort function (sort a list using a “natural order” algorithm) [duplicate]

From my answer to Natural Sorting algorithm:

import re
def natural_key(string_):
    """See https://blog.codinghorror.com/sorting-for-humans-natural-sort-order/"""
    return [int(s) if s.isdigit() else s for s in re.split(r'(\d+)', string_)]

Example:

>>> L = ['image1.jpg', 'image15.jpg', 'image12.jpg', 'image3.jpg']
>>> sorted(L)
['image1.jpg', 'image12.jpg', 'image15.jpg', 'image3.jpg']
>>> sorted(L, key=natural_key)
['image1.jpg', 'image3.jpg', 'image12.jpg', 'image15.jpg']

To support Unicode strings, .isdecimal() should be used instead of .isdigit(). See example in @phihag’s comment. Related: How to reveal Unicodes numeric value property.

.isdigit() may also fail (return value that is not accepted by int()) for a bytestring on Python 2 in some locales e.g., ‘\xb2’ (‘²’) in cp1252 locale on Windows.
